In Mar del Plata, Argentina, a single person typically needs around $748 per month including rent. A family of four may spend about $1832 monthly.
Mar del Plata is 15% cheaper overall versus the European benchmark.
Mar del Plata is 68% cheaper than New York City, without rent.
Rent in Mar del Plata is, on average, 89% lower than in New York City.
Mar del Plata is most realistic when moving with a strong job offer or relocation package. Without high income, the housing-driven price level can be difficult to sustain.
The main driver of expenses in Mar del Plata is rent and utilities, which can significantly impact overall living costs.
Food prices are only 1% higher than the European benchmark, making them relatively manageable.
Public transport is very affordable, being 52% lower than the European benchmark.
